The is a critical extra-embryonic membrane found in the embryos of reptiles, birds, and mammals that primarily functions in waste storage and gas exchange . In egg-laying species, it acts as a repository for nitrogenous waste and works with the chorion to facilitate respiration, while in most mammals, it evolves to form the structure of the umbilical cord. 1. : In these egg-layers, the allantois expands until it fuses with the chorion to form the chorioallantoic membrane . This membrane serves as a "lung," allowing oxygen to enter the egg and carbon dioxide to leave. It also acts as a storage tank for uric acid, a non-toxic form of nitrogenous waste.
